Hi, to confirm for jailbroken users, yes, there is a way to hide the
news stand folder. Springtomize does this, as well as various other
tweaks from Cydia.

May I suggest that you simply move that folder to your last page and forget
about it. You can't delete it and you can't put it into another folder
either as far as I know.

I just move all apps I don't really use to the last page of apps, for
example, if you have apps and folders on 3 pages, just move all the stock
apps you don't want to use onto the fourth page. Alternatively, you could
create a folder and call it "Unused Apps" or something like that. That is
not the same as completely hiding or deleting it, but I find it just as
good.
